ND-LWS Leaf Wetness Sensor
What is the ND-LWS? The ND-LWS is a leaf wetness sensor that detects condensation, dew and rainfall on a leaf-like surface — the critical input for plant disease prediction models. With sub-microsecond resolution and clear thresholds (LW < 0.11 dry, ≥ 0.11 wet, ≥ 0.27 totally wet), it powers outdoor remote monitoring, smart agriculture, plant disease and infection prevention and greenhouse / soil-less plantation deployments connected to the yDoc ML-525 datalogger.

Specifications
Technical specifications
| Parameter | Property | Value |
|---|---|---|
| Leaf wetness | Threshold (dry) | LW < 0.11 |
| Threshold (wet) | LW ≥ 0.11 | |
| Threshold (totally wet) | LW ≥ 0.27 | |
| Resolution | < 0.000001 | |
| Mechanical | Cable | 5 m (custom lengths on request) |
| Mounting | Within plant canopy, leaf-mimicking surface | |
| Output | Protocol | SDI-12 |
| Compatibility | yDoc ML-525 datalogger |
Applications
Where the ND-LWS is used
Outdoor remote monitoring
Long-term canopy wetness monitoring in remote orchards and field stations.
Smart agriculture
Site-specific spraying decisions based on actual leaf wetness duration.
Plant disease prevention
Drive Decision Support Systems for fungal pathogen risk in vines, fruit and field crops.
Greenhouses & soil-less
Canopy condensation monitoring for climate control and disease management in protected cropping.
Integration
Powered by the yDoc ML-525 datalogger
The ND-LWS connects directly to the yDoc ML-525 datalogger. The yDoc powers the sensor, schedules measurements, stores readings locally and transmits them to the Sensor-Online platform via 4G/LTE-M, NB-IoT, LoRaWAN, satellite or Ethernet — with up to 10 years of battery life.
